The Malaysian government has rolled out an express immigration channel for citizens using the MyNIISe QR code system at Bangunan Sultan Iskandar, the main bus departure point for cross-border travel into Singapore. Home Minister Datuk Seri Saifuddin Nasution Ismail announced the initiative, which began operation at dedicated counters 9 and 10 in the Bus Departure Hall. The accelerated clearance service operates during the most congested period of the day, from 4.30 am to 8 am, when thousands of Malaysian workers and commuters typically depart for Singapore.
The timing of this announcement reflects the government's recognition of a persistent logistical challenge that affects hundreds of thousands of cross-border commuters. Daily travellers to Singapore who leave during the early morning window face considerable delays as they navigate standard immigration procedures while racing against tight work schedules. Many depart before dawn to secure bus seats and ensure timely arrival at their workplaces across the causeway. This creates a cascading effect where congestion at immigration counters directly translates into late arrivals, missed connections, and operational inefficiencies for both individual commuters and employers relying on Malaysian workers.
MyNIISe, the National Integrated Immigration System, represents a cornerstone of Malaysia's digital transformation agenda within the immigration framework. The system streamlines border processing by consolidating traveller information and allowing pre-clearance verification through a mobile application interface. Rather than queuing at physical counters with passport documents, users with the QR code can proceed through expedited lanes where immigration officers scan the code and retrieve all necessary travel and identity information instantly. This technological approach significantly reduces the time required for manual document checks and questioning, addressing both efficiency and capacity constraints at busy border crossings.
Access to the MyNIISe system is straightforward for Malaysian citizens and residents. The application can be downloaded from three major platforms—Apple App Store, Google Play Store, and Huawei App Gallery—ensuring compatibility across the vast majority of smartphones in use. The priority clearance initiative specifically targets the morning peak period, which is when the bottleneck most severely impacts commuters and overall border efficiency. Between 4.30 am and 8 am, Bangunan Sultan Iskandar typically processes thousands of passengers, with conventional immigration procedures creating significant delays. By designating counters 9 and 10 exclusively for MyNIISe QR users during this window, the government effectively creates a two-tier system that incentivizes digital adoption while maintaining capacity for those using traditional methods. This phased approach allows the immigration authority to gather performance data and gradually shift more traffic to digital channels as adoption increases.
For the broader Malaysian economy, this development carries implications beyond mere convenience. The cross-border workforce represents a significant economic relationship between Malaysia and Singapore, with tens of thousands of Malaysians employed across various sectors in Singapore's economy. Reducing commute friction directly improves worker punctuality and productivity while lowering transportation costs associated with congestion-related delays. Employers in Singapore benefit from more reliable workforce availability, while Malaysian commuters gain tangible time savings that translate into reduced stress and improved work-life balance. Cumulatively, these individual benefits aggregate into measurable economic gains across both nations.

The initiative also touches on broader questions about digital equity and access in Malaysia. While smartphone penetration is high, ensuring that all eligible commuters have access to the technology and data necessary to use the system requires attention to affordability and digital literacy. The government may need to provide additional support channels for users unfamiliar with mobile applications, particularly among older workers who form a meaningful segment of the cross-border commuting population. Without such measures, the priority lanes could inadvertently advantage younger, more digitally fluent commuters while disadvantaging older workers.
